Output 50862e7df81d8e7cd12c0011172502b3dec7f94145d1c7039ec60722e5bc99e4:0

value
3095257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166a411b221e1829f550f5fc5df50f9b7a94bda2 OP_EQUAL
address
33jY5SgbjffghzSkDnyg3bS4QXofy5qFrB
transaction
50862e7df81d8e7cd12c0011172502b3dec7f94145d1c7039ec60722e5bc99e4
spent
true